mysql初始密码是什么

初始MySQL密码为空或由安装过程设置。

对于MySQL的初始密码,具体情况取决于安装方式和版本。
下面是MySQL初始密码的详细解释:

1新安装或恢复的MySQL:对于新安装的MySQL服务器或恢复的服务器,初始密码通常为空。
这意味着安装完成后,您将需要设置密码。
某些安装程序可能会要求您在安装过程中输入密码。

2通过安装包安装MySQL:如果通过下载MySQL安装包进行安装,安装过程中可能会提示输入root用户密码。
该密码是可自定义的,取决于您的设置。

3使用第三方软件管理工具安装MySQL:在某些操作系统上,例如Ubuntu,可以通过APT等软件包管理工具安装MySQL。
在这种情况下,可能没有明确的初始密码,或者密码策略可能由系统管理员或软件更新策略控制。

4企业版或自定义安装的MySQL:对于企业版或自定义安装的MySQL版本,初始密码策略可能更复杂。
这可能包括默认密码策略,您可能需要查阅相关文档或联系您的管理员来获取初始密码。

无论哪种情况,出于安全原因,您应该在知道原始密码或设置新密码后更改默认密码,并确保遵循良好的密码安全实践,例如使用强密码和定期更换等等。
另外,对于生产环境中的数据库服务器,还应该考虑启用额外的安全措施,例如防火墙规则、访问控制等。

解决方法MySQL初始密码缺失怎么办mysql不显示初始密码

MySQL是一种流行的开源关系数据库管理系统,通常用于网站开发和数据存储。
但如果在安装MySQL时不指定初始密码,可能会导致初始密码丢失。
如果您遇到这种情况,不用担心,下面将为您介绍MySQL初始密码丢失的解决方法。
方法一:使用默认密码MySQL在安装时会设置一个默认密码,您可以直接使用该密码登录。
常见的默认密码是空密码、root或mysql。
如果您尚未设置密码,请尝试这些默认密码。
方法二:使用-skip-grant-tables选项重置密码该方法需要在MySQL服务启动中添加-skip-grant-tables参数,然后重新启动MySQL服务。
该选项允许任何人登录MySQL,因此请谨慎使用。
部分步骤如下:1.要停止MySQL服务,请在终端(或命令行)中输入以下命令:sudosystemctlstopmysql2使用–skip-grant-tables参数停止MySQL服务:sudomysqld–skip-grant-tables&3然后使用MySQL命令行工具(mysql)登录MySQL,无需输入密码,可以直接登录MySQL命令行。
但请注意,此时输入的用户权限可能会受到限制,例如只能读取数据,而不能更改或删除数据。
sudomysql4。
您可以使用以下命令来更改密码。
在这里,将用户名root和密码new_password替换为您的用户名和新密码。
升级到MySQL并使用新密码。
方法3:创建并运行脚本如果您不熟悉命令行,可以使用脚本来重置MySQL密码。
创建一个reset_mysql_password.sql文件:UPDATEmysql.userSETauthentication_string=PASSWORD('newpassword')WHEREUser='root'ANDHost='localhost';FLUSHPRIVILEGES;newpassword'将其替换为您要设置的新密码。
然后执行以下命令:sudomysqld–init-file=/path/to/reset_mysql_password.sql&/path/to/是reset_mysql_password.sql文件的路径。
执行完成后,关闭MySQL并重新启动服务。
总结以上就是解决MySQL初始密码丢失问题的方法。
使用过程中请注意不要更改MySQL密码,以免出现不必要的问题。
如果您不确定自己所做的事情是否安全,请咨询专业人士或查看官方文档。